This is a program that allows students who meet the necessary success criteria and other conditions to take courses simultaneously from two different departments/programs with which the institution has agreements and obtain two separate diplomas. Students can enroll in only one major program at a time.
The application conditions and requirements are as follows:
Students can apply for a second major diploma program in the third semester at the earliest and in the fifth semester at the latest for four-year programs, in the seventh semester at the latest for five-year programs, and in the ninth semester at the latest for six-year programs in their major diploma program. For associate degree diploma programs, students can apply in the second semester at the earliest and in the third semester at the latest.
At the time of application, students must have a minimum general grade point average (GPA) of 70 out of 100 in their major diploma program and must be in the top 20% of the success ranking in their major diploma program.
To be eligible to apply for the double major diploma program, the student must successfully complete all the courses taken in the major diploma program until the semester they are applying for.
To graduate from the double major program, the student must have a minimum general GPA of 70 out of 100. Throughout the entire double major program, the student's general GPA may temporarily drop to as low as 65 out of 100. If the general GPA drops below 65 out of 100 for a second time, the student's registration in the double major diploma program is canceled. A student who continues in the second major undergraduate program can only receive the graduation diploma after graduating from the first major diploma program. The courses taken by the student in the major program and deemed equivalent in the second major diploma program are shown in the grade table. The maximum duration for students who have obtained the right to graduate from the major diploma program but could not complete the second major diploma program is determined by the Senate, starting from the academic year in which they enrolled in the second major diploma program, in accordance with Article 44/c of Law No. 2547. If a student does not take courses in the double major program for two consecutive semesters, their registration in the second major diploma program is canceled. The evaluation of the courses in which the student was successful in the second major program but not accepted in the major program is determined by the Senate. The courses in which the student was successful in the second major program but not accepted in the major program are included in the transcript and diploma supplement without being included in the general GPA.
Students enrolled in a specific program, who meet the specified criteria, can obtain a minor certificate by taking a limited number of courses related to a particular subject, which does not replace their diploma. Students can apply for a minor program in their third semester at the earliest and in the sixth semester at the latest in their major undergraduate program. Students who have successfully completed all the credit courses in their undergraduate program until the semester they are applying for can apply. The student must have a minimum general GPA of 65 out of 100 in their major program at the time of application.
